U+536F "" CJK Unified Ideograph-# is a Chinese character historically used to denote the fourth Earthly Branch in the traditional Chinese sexagenary cycle, corresponding to the sign of the Rabbit in the Chinese zodiac. It represents the direction of east by east-north and is associated with the early morning hours, specifically from 5 a.m. to 7 a.m. In East Asian cultures, particularly in Japan and China, the character also appears in compound words and names, such as in the term "卯月" (uzuki) which refers to the fourth month of the lunar calendar, roughly April.
